Understanding AI-Driven Solutions
What are AI-Driven Solutions?
AI-driven solutions are technologies and applications that utilize artificial intelligence to perform tasks that typically require human intelligence. This includes:
- Learning: Acquiring knowledge and improving performance through experience.
- Reasoning: Applying logic and deduction to solve problems.
- Problem-solving: Identifying and implementing effective solutions.
- Perception: Understanding and interpreting sensory data (e.g., images, audio).
- Natural Language Processing (NLP): Understanding and generating human language.
AI-driven solutions leverage various AI techniques like machine learning, deep learning, natural language processing, and computer vision to analyze data, identify patterns, and make predictions or decisions.
The Core Components of AI Systems
AI systems generally comprise the following components:
- Data: Large volumes of structured and unstructured data used for training and operation.
- Algorithms: Mathematical models that learn from the data and perform specific tasks.
- Infrastructure: Hardware and software resources required to support the AI system (e.g., cloud computing, GPUs).
- Applications: The specific tasks or problems that the AI system is designed to solve.
Applications of AI-Driven Solutions Across Industries
Healthcare: Revolutionizing Patient Care
AI is transforming healthcare through applications such as:
- Diagnosis and Treatment: AI algorithms can analyze medical images (X-rays, MRIs) to detect diseases earlier and more accurately. For instance, AI-powered tools can assist radiologists in identifying subtle anomalies in mammograms, leading to earlier breast cancer detection.
- Drug Discovery: AI accelerates the process of identifying and developing new drugs by analyzing vast amounts of biological data. AI can predict the efficacy and safety of potential drug candidates, reducing the time and cost associated with traditional drug discovery methods.
- Personalized Medicine: AI analyzes patient data to tailor treatment plans based on individual needs and characteristics. By considering factors like genetics, lifestyle, and medical history, AI can help doctors develop more effective and targeted treatment strategies.
Finance: Enhancing Efficiency and Security
The financial sector is heavily leveraging AI for:
- Fraud Detection: AI algorithms can analyze transaction data in real-time to identify and prevent fraudulent activities. Machine learning models can detect patterns and anomalies that indicate fraudulent behavior, helping banks and financial institutions protect their customers and assets.
- Risk Management: AI helps financial institutions assess and manage risk more effectively. By analyzing market data, economic indicators, and customer behavior, AI can predict potential risks and provide insights for better decision-making.
- Algorithmic Trading: AI-powered trading systems can execute trades automatically based on pre-defined rules and algorithms. Algorithmic trading can improve efficiency, reduce human error, and potentially increase profitability.
Retail: Improving Customer Experience and Operations
AI is reshaping the retail landscape through:
- Personalized Recommendations: AI algorithms analyze customer data to provide personalized product recommendations. These recommendations can be based on past purchases, browsing history, and demographic information, leading to increased sales and customer satisfaction.
- Inventory Management: AI optimizes inventory levels by predicting demand and minimizing stockouts. AI can analyze sales data, seasonal trends, and external factors to forecast demand and ensure that the right products are available at the right time.
- Chatbots and Virtual Assistants: AI-powered chatbots provide instant customer support and answer frequently asked questions. Chatbots can handle a large volume of customer inquiries simultaneously, freeing up human agents to focus on more complex issues.
Benefits of Implementing AI-Driven Solutions
Increased Efficiency and Productivity
AI automates repetitive tasks, freeing up human employees to focus on more strategic and creative activities. By automating tasks such as data entry, report generation, and customer support, AI can significantly increase efficiency and productivity across the organization.
Improved Accuracy and Decision-Making
AI algorithms analyze data with greater accuracy and speed than humans, leading to better decision-making. AI can identify patterns and insights that humans may miss, enabling businesses to make more informed and data-driven decisions.
Enhanced Customer Experience
AI personalizes customer interactions and provides faster, more convenient service. AI-powered chatbots, personalized recommendations, and targeted marketing campaigns can enhance the customer experience and increase customer loyalty.
Cost Reduction
AI automates tasks, reduces errors, and optimizes resource allocation, leading to significant cost savings. By reducing the need for manual labor, minimizing waste, and improving efficiency, AI can help businesses lower their operational costs.

Implementing AI-Driven Solutions: A Practical Guide
Identify Business Needs
Start by identifying specific business problems or opportunities that AI can address. Conduct a thorough assessment of your current processes and identify areas where AI can improve efficiency, accuracy, or customer experience.
Choose the Right AI Technologies
Select the appropriate AI technologies based on your specific needs and the available data. Consider factors such as the complexity of the problem, the amount and quality of available data, and the expertise of your team.
Data Preparation and Management
Ensure that your data is clean, well-structured, and accessible for AI algorithms to use. Invest in data preparation tools and techniques to ensure data quality and consistency.
Build or Buy?
Decide whether to build your own AI solutions or purchase pre-built solutions from vendors. Building your own solutions gives you greater control and customization, but it requires significant expertise and resources. Purchasing pre-built solutions can be faster and more cost-effective, but it may not be as tailored to your specific needs.
Start Small and Scale Gradually
Begin with a pilot project to test the feasibility and effectiveness of the AI solution. Once you have proven the value of the AI solution, scale it gradually across the organization.
Overcoming Challenges in AI Implementation
Data Availability and Quality
Ensure that you have access to sufficient high-quality data for training AI models. Address issues such as data bias, missing data, and data inconsistencies.
Talent Acquisition
Hire or train skilled AI professionals who can develop, implement, and maintain AI solutions. Consider investing in training programs to upskill your existing workforce.
Ethical Considerations
Address ethical concerns related to AI, such as bias, privacy, and transparency. Implement safeguards to ensure that AI systems are used responsibly and ethically.
